Denali National Park

Denali implies "Superb One," and the name fits! Dwelling of Mt. McKinley, the highest peak in North America, this giant stretches more than 20,000 feet into the sky. But this isn't the only awesome sight in the park. Equally as impressive are the glacial landscape and the "Large Five" wildlife inhabitants: grizzly bears, caribou, wolves, Dall sheep and moose.

This park is actually "organic" in that it has been maintained to serve its original residents: the animals. 1 road moves automobile targeted traffic in and out of the park to preserve order. Look about. Take a deep breath. "Back to nature" has never ever been a even more appropriate saying than when you're standing in the midst of Denali National Park.

Kluane National Park

One of the largest international land preserves on earth, Kluane National Park has been named a UNESCO World Heritage Web page. A frozen tundra Kluane boasts the highest mountain in Canada - Mt. Logan - as properly as some of the largest and thickest glaciers in the globe.

With rivers of ice, vast ice fields and enormous glaciers, Kluane is usually blanketed with a solid layer of frozen water such as glaciers that are up to one mile thick. It is truly like walking into a land prior to time.

Alaska Railroad

Cruise ships are the most beneficial way to go to various destinations nevertheless, they have one drawback. They do require water in order to operate. Because inland Alaska is far from the ocean's shore, you'll merely will need to transfer to another delightful form of transportation: The Alaska Railroad.

Reaching from Seward to Fairbanks, you will enjoy the view of extraordinary scenery as you gaze via massive picture windows. This form of luxury rail travel is complete with dining vehicle, viewing deck, upper-level dome area, restrooms and comfy seating.

With numerous tours with varying costs, it's effortless to escape to the inland areas of Alaska that you would have otherwise missed.
